卡商对接API接码通常指的是与第三方服务供应商(如短信服务提供商)进行集成,以便通过其API接口发送短信验证码或其他类型的消息。这个过程涉及到几个关键步骤,包括注册API密钥、集成API接口、测试和优化等。以下是详细的步骤和注意事项。
1、注册API密钥:你需要在卡商(短信服务提供商)的平台上注册一个账户,并获取API密钥或令牌,这通常涉及到填写一些个人信息和公司信息,并验证你的身份。
2、了解API文档:获取API密钥后,你需要仔细阅读卡商的API文档,这将告诉你如何构造请求,包括必要的参数、格式和认证方式等。
3、集成API接口:根据你的开发需求和平台(如Java、Python、PHP等),编写代码来调用卡商的API,这通常涉及到发送HTTP请求,包括POST或GET请求,以及处理响应。
4、处理响应和错误:确保你的代码能够正确处理API的响应,包括成功响应和可能出现的错误,这通常涉及到检查响应状态码和错误消息。

5、测试:在集成完成后,进行彻底的测试以确保一切正常工作,这包括测试发送短信验证码、接收响应以及处理异常情况等。
6、优化和监控:一旦系统上线,持续监控系统的性能,并根据需要进行优化,这可能涉及到调整请求频率、处理失败的重试策略等。
注意事项:
1、安全性:确保在传输敏感数据(如API密钥)时使用安全的连接方式(如HTTPS),不要在代码中硬编码敏感信息,而是使用安全的方式存储和管理这些信息。
2、遵循最佳实践:遵循编程和API集成的最佳实践,以确保系统的稳定性和安全性。

3、文档更新:如果卡商更新了他们的API或文档,确保及时跟进这些变化并更新你的代码。
4、错误处理:确保你的代码能够妥善处理各种错误情况,包括网络错误、API错误等。
5、性能考虑:考虑到短信服务的特性,可能需要考虑并发请求的处理能力、延迟等因素。
由于具体的实现细节会根据不同的卡商和API有所不同,因此建议详细阅读卡商的官方文档并按照其指导进行操作,如果你遇到任何问题或困难,可以联系卡商的技术支持团队寻求帮助。





